Cranberry Cream Cheese Crescent Bites

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 can crescent roll dough (8-count)
  • 4 oz cream cheese (softened)
  • ¼ cup powdered sugar
  • ½ tsp vanilla extract
  • ½ cup whole berry cranberry sauce
  • Optional: chopped pecans or orange zest for topping

Instructions

  1. Preheat your oven to 375°F.
  2. Grease or line a mini muffin tin with liners.
  3. In a bowl, mix softened cream cheese, powdered sugar, and vanilla until smooth.
  4. Unroll crescent roll dough and cut each triangle in half. Press into muffin cups.
  5. Spoon 1 teaspoon of cream cheese mixture into each pocket, followed by 1 teaspoon of cranberry sauce.
  6. Bake for 11–13 minutes until golden brown.
  7. Allow to cool slightly before serving.
